목록전체 글 (462)
코드네임 :

그냥.. 드림핵에서 Flask 혼공하라는 식으로 얘기하시길래 걍 인프런에서 기초 배우고 무작정 따라하기 강의 우선 들어보려고 합니긔근데 얘도 걍 무작정 따라하는거라.. 좀 보고^^ 다시 드림핵으로 나중에 다시 공부할수도 잇는거궁 https://www.inflearn.com/course/웹해킹-보안-시큐어코딩?attributionToken=iQHwiAoMCIviosIGEO2e2fkBEAEaJDY4NjBjYjA0LTAwMDAtMjExYi1hOTE0LTNjMjg2ZDQyZDAyZSoHMTA3NjQ0ODIs9ujDMKOAlyLFy_MX1LKdFcLwnhWo5aottbeMLZzWty2Q97Iwmu7GMJ_Wty06DmRlZmF1bHRfc2VhcmNoSAFYAWABaAF6AnNp 웹 개발자와 정보보안 입문자가 꼭 ..

강의 수강에 필요한 사전지식...이요? ㅋㅋ [ HTTP vs HTTPS ]HTTP (HyperText Transfer Protocol): 웹 브라우저와 웹 서버가 텍스트, 이미지, 영상 등을 주고받는 약속된 규칙🧠 쉽게 말하면:브라우저: “나 이 글 보고 싶어!”서버: “알겠어, 이 HTML 파일 줄게!”- HTTP는 도청당하기 쉬움 (패킷을 가로채면 비밀번호, 쿠키 등이 유출될 수 있음) ㄴ 해커들이 중간자 공격을 자주 노림 HTTPS (HTTP + Secure): 암호화된 통신- TLS/SSL을 사용해서 통신 내용 보호 [ 쿠키와 세션 ]📎 왜 필요한가?: 웹은 기본적으로 "상태를 기억하지 못하는 프로토콜" -> 로그인하고 다음 페이지로 넘어가면 누군지 모름 -> 따라서 정보 저장 ..
Component란?: 화면에 보여줄 조각function Hello() { return 안녕!;} Server Component : 서버에서 실행됨ㄴ 브라우저가 아닌 서버에서 렌더링됨- 민감한 API 키나 DB 접근이 필요한 경우 등에서 서버 컴포넌트로 만듦 (보안성)// 이건 서버에서 실행됨 (브라우저가 아닌)// 서버 컴포넌트export default async function PostList() { const res = await fetch('https://api.example.com/posts'); const data = await res.json(); return ( {data.map((post) => ( {post.title} ))} );}..

https://ramincoding.tistory.com/m/entry/Frontend-스웨거swagger-API-사용하는-방법-feat-리액트 [Frontend] 스웨거(swagger) API 사용하는 방법 (feat. 리액트)[Frontend] 스웨거(swagger) API 사용하는 방법 (feat. 리액트) 프론트엔드 개발자로써 첫 회사에 들어가자마자 스웨거 API 링크를 받았다. 멋사에서 프로젝트할 때 서버리스로 Firebase 만 써본 입장에서ramincoding.tistory.com 연결할때 참고할 것! HTTP클라이언트(사용자)와 서버간에 요청(Request)와 응답(Response)메시지를 주고 받는 프로토콜ㄴ iOS앱은 HTTP를 통해 서버에 데이터 요청 후, 서버로부터 JSON, 이미지..
보호되어 있는 글입니다.
보호되어 있는 글입니다.

자 저는 감자기 때문에봐도 봐도 모르기 때문에 강의를 다시보며 합니당. ㅋ Props : 43 44 다른 파일에서 해당 메소드 사용가능하려면export default function Header { ~~} 그리고 다른 파일에서 가져오려면import Header from './components/Header.jsx' 48강의 - children 49 이벤트 처리하기 (onClick 같은거)50, 51(매개변수 파라미터 넣어주는 경우는 종류 구별할때??) 52 tabcontent button 53 reactHook와 state , 54 뭐 아래 내용 여러개 뜨게 하던거 {isEdit ? "게시글 수정" : "게시글 작성"} ..

자 토이프로젝트로 인해 제가 이런걸 처음 해봐야 할 일이 생겼습니다? 지피티에게 열심히 물어보앗다1단계: GitHub 리포지토리를 내 VS Code에 클론하기git clone https://github.com/(해당깃허브주소) (ex.git clone https://github.com/abc/C-FINAL-FE.gitcd 리포지토리명(ex)C-FINAL-FE)code . code . 하니까 이게 열림 2단계: GitHub에 브랜치 만들기 (VScode 터미널에서)// main 브랜치 기준으로 eunjung 브랜치를 로컬과 원격에 동시에 만드는 명령어git checkout -b 브랜치명 git push -u origin 브랜치명 3단계: 브랜치에서 작업하기내 브랜치로 전환되어 있어야 함git branch#..